Historical Context:
The Alfa Romeo 75 (Milano in North America) was the successor to the Alfa Romeo Alfetta and Alfa Romeo Giulietta. It represented a blend of sporty performance, Italian design flair, and unique engineering features. Positioned as a compact executive car with a strong sporting pedigree.
Competitors:
Competed against cars like the BMW 3 Series, Mercedes-Benz 190E, Audi 80/90, and other sporty sedans of its era.
Design Philosophy:
Distinctive wedge shape, rear-mounted transaxle for optimal weight distribution and handling, rear-wheel drive, independent suspension all around, and the characteristic Alfa Romeo Busso V6 engine.

Engine Type:
V6 SOHC (2.5) / V6 DOHC (3.0)
Displacement 2.5:
2492 cc (152.1 cu in)
Displacement 3.0:
2959 cc (180.6 cu in)
Horsepower 2.5:
Approximately 155-180 hp (depending on market and version)
Torque 2.5:
Approximately 220-230 Nm (162-170 lb-ft)
Horsepower 3.0:
Approximately 187-196 hp
Torque 3.0:
Approximately 245-255 Nm (181-188 lb-ft)
Fuel Delivery 2.5:
Bosch L-Jetronic fuel injection
Fuel Delivery 3.0:
Bosch Motronic fuel injection
Layout:
Front-engine, rear-wheel drive
Engine Code Busso:
The legendary 'Busso' V6 engine, known for its distinctive sound and performance characteristics.

Engine Oil Change:
Typically every 5,000-7,500 miles or 6-12 months. Refer to manual for exact specification and oil type.
Timing Belt Replacement:
Critical for the V6 engine. Typically every 30,000-60,000 miles or 3-5 years, depending on conditions. Failure can lead to catastrophic engine damage.
Engine Oil:
API SG/SH or higher, SAE 10W-40 or 15W-50 recommended (check manual for specific viscosity based on climate and usage).
Coolant:
Ethylene glycol-based antifreeze, typically a 50/50 mix with distilled water. Check manual for specific type (e.g., silicate-free).
Brake Fluid:
DOT 3 or DOT 4 (check manual for specific requirement, typically replaced every 2 years due to hygroscopic nature).
Rust Prone Areas:
Wheel arches, sills, door bottoms, rear suspension mounting points. Thorough inspection and prevention are key.
Electrical Gremlins:
Common in older Italian cars; corrosion in connectors, aging wiring harnesses, and failing relays can cause intermittent issues. The manual's wiring diagrams and troubleshooting section are invaluable.
Engine Cooling System:
Thermostat issues, leaks from hoses and water pump are not uncommon. Regular coolant flushes are essential.
Transaxle Clunk:
Some owners report a 'clunk' on gear changes, often related to worn U-joints in the driveshaft or worn bushings in the linkage or suspension. The manual will detail inspection and replacement.
Rubber Components:
Age-related degradation of rubber hoses, mounts, and bushings can affect various systems.
